2 x 1 ground floor unit with garden outlook in a well maintained complex. Unit comprises of kitchen with gas cooking and combined meals/living area, which opens out to a small private balcony area. Neutral colours throughout.
There is a shared laundry for all occupants. You also get 1x undercover car bay and visitor parking is available. Close to transport, shops and all that Fremantle has to offer.

A popular destination for both residents and visitors alike, the suburb is a mixed-use area with its five square kilometres used for residential, commercial, institutional, maritime and industrial purposes.
Busy, energetic and always alive, Fremantle is arguably the second busiest city sector of Western Australia. Enjoy alfresco dining on the cappuccino strip, which runs through a section of South Terrace, take a stroll along the Fishing Boat Harbour and stop in for a drink and a feed at Little Creatures Brewery. Pubs, clubs, shops and markets are all in abundance in Fremantle, making it a popular destination on a night out and the suburb is also home to several popular annual festivals, which attract people from all over the metropolitan area. The Fremantle Railway Station provides convenient access into Perth City.
